Atherstone to Edinburgh Park by train

A train trip from Atherstone to Edinburgh Park takes about 5hrs 45 mins on average, covering roughly 242 miles (389 kilometres). With around 15 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£70.10,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

What are my cheap ticket options for Atherstone to Edinburgh Park journeys?

From booking in Advance, to our FairSplits, here are our tips for you to find the best price

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Atherstone to Edinburgh Park start from as little as £70.10

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Atherstone to Edinburgh Park start from £115.80 one way, or £165.50 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Atherstone to Edinburgh Park are available for £151.00 one way, or £302.00 return

Station Facilities and Amenities

Though the station lacks a traditional ticket office, fret not as ticket machines are available where you can collect tickets purchased online. These machines are accessible and inclusive, ensuring that everyone can navigate them with ease. For those reliant on hearing aids, induction loops are installed to assist with auditory requirements. Although there are no physical help desks, assistance is available at designated help points.

Despite the convenience, there are no restroom facilities, waiting rooms, or food and drinks available on site. However, there’s a seating area for those brief pauses, allowing you to rest as you wait for your train. It's worth noting the absence of ATM services, so remember to carry any cash you may need. The station also implements CCTV surveillance to ensure passenger safety.

Accessibility and Support

Atherstone Station proudly offers step-free access to all platforms, classified under category B1, meaning there might be long or steep ramps. Patrons with reduced mobility will find accessible parking spaces and impaired mobility set-down points at their service. If you need further assistance, make prior arrangements through Passenger Assist, a service designed for those who require additional help.

For cyclists, there are 12 spaces equipped with stands for bike storage, although the parking area isn't sheltered. Car parking is available with 17 spaces, including two accessible ones. Charges apply, with daily rates starting at £3.50 and various other packages available for more extended periods. Ensure you use the Saba App for payments.

Facilities and Services

Despite its functional design, Edinburgh Park does not shy away from offering helpful services that make your journey as smooth as possible. Whilst the station doesn't have a staffed ticket office, rest assured that ticket machines are available for collecting pre-purchased tickets. For those needing assistance, an induction loop is in place at the station, and any online-bought tickets can be conveniently collected here. However, it's worth noting there are no smartcard facilities.

For your comfort and safety, the station is equipped with CCTV and customer help points to ensure safe travel. Though there's no luggage storage or specific assistance for those with mobility issues, Edinburgh Park promotes an accessible environment with step-free access to all areas. But keep in mind; there are no accessible toilets or baby changing facilities available here.

Getting to and from Edinburgh Park

Edinburgh Park’s connectivity extends beyond the tracks, offering numerous transport links. A handy tram service is situated right beside the station, whisking you from Edinburgh Airport to the heart of the city at York Place. Bus services are abundant, with stops positioned conveniently adjacent to Hermiston Gait. For those requiring replacement rail services, buses operate from a nearby location, with specific details accessible [here](https://w3w.co/eager.news.dogs).

For a quick taxi service, visitors can refer to traintaxi.co.uk to locate a reliable cab. Unfortunately, the station lacks its taxi rank or car hire services, so planning in advance could prevent any delays in travel.
